Ticket: Sign-off — GiveNote donation-receipt mailer template update

For future maintainers: this change migrates the GiveNote receipt mailer to the new templating engine and adds per-region tax wording. Rendering is verified against the snapshot suite; send throughput is unchanged. Deployment is blocked until written sign-off is obtained from the engineer accountable for the mailer.

named custodian: Brivan Eliath Quenox Frador

## Artifact Signing for GraphWeave Plugins

All third-party plugins for the GraphWeave dependency visualizer must be signed before the registry will list them. Signing covers the packaged archive, not individual files, so rebuild and re-sign after any change. Verification happens at install time and again at load time. The current release signing key is published below for your verification tooling.

signing key of bagap-yawep = bky13_TbfT6ZMUoGJo2

## Audit item 7 — Undo/Redo stack (SketchLoom)

Check that the undo/redo history in SketchLoom's diagram editor doesn't hang onto deleted sensitive shapes longer than it should. Verify the stack is capped, cleared on document close, and never serialized into autosave files in plaintext. Also poke at redo-after-permission-change — that bit us once. For questions or to book a walkthrough, the accountable engineer is listed below.

approver of bagug-bagag = Holael Pramir